How Long Do Delta 8 Gummies Last After Consumption?
Most people start to feel the effects within an hour, and these can last for several hours. Dose, metabolism, and food intake all affect timing and strength.
Typical Duration of Effects
Effects generally last about 4–8 hours. Low doses (5–10 mg) tend to wear off by 4 hours. Higher doses (25–50 mg) can stretch effects up to 6–8 hours.
Your body weight and metabolism play a role. If you have a faster metabolism, you may process delta-8 THC more quickly. Eating a fatty meal before or with a gummy can make the effects last longer by increasing absorption.
Tolerance also matters. Regular use can make effects feel shorter and less intense. Start with a low dose and increase slowly to find what works for you.
Peak Effects and Tapering Off
Peak effects usually happen 1.5–3 hours after you eat a gummy. During this time, you may feel the strongest psychoactive effects, relaxation, or changes in perception.
After the peak, effects gradually fade. Most noticeable sensations diminish over 2–4 hours, sometimes leaving mild after-effects like drowsiness or slower thinking. These usually clear by 8–12 hours.
If you need to stay alert, avoid driving or heavy tasks during the peak and taper period. Always follow safety guidance and product directions.
Onset Time and Delayed Onset
For most people, onset time ranges from 30 minutes to 2 hours. You may not feel anything for an hour, then notice gradual changes as your body digests the gummy and absorbs cannabinoids.
Because of this delay, some people take extra doses too soon. Wait at least 2–3 hours before taking more, unless product instructions say otherwise. If effects feel too strong, stay calm, hydrate, and rest in a safe place.
If you want a faster onset, consider sublingual or inhaled options. For edibles, plan your dose and timing to fit your schedule and responsibilities.
Factors That Influence Duration
Personal and product factors affect how long delta 8 gummies last. Knowing these helps you plan your dose, timing, and activities safely.
How the Body Processes Edibles
According to the National Center for Complementary and Integrative Health (NCCIH), the body processes cannabinoids more slowly when taken orally compared to inhaled forms. This slower absorption explains why Delta 8 gummies may have a delayed onset and longer-lasting effects.
Edibles must pass through digestion and liver metabolism before entering the bloodstream, which extends both onset and duration. Knowing this helps you avoid redosing too early and experiencing stronger effects than planned.
Metabolism and Body Chemistry
Your metabolism affects how quickly your body processes delta 8 gummies. If your metabolism is faster, you may feel the effects start and end sooner. A slower metabolism can make effects last longer.
Delta 8 is fat-soluble, so higher body fat can store cannabinoids and release them slowly, stretching the effects over more hours. Hydration and liver enzyme activity also play a role.
Genetics influence liver enzymes like CYP450, which affect how quickly your body activates and clears THC gummies. Tell your healthcare provider about medications that affect liver enzymes.
Dosage and Tolerance
Higher doses of delta 8 gummies usually last longer than smaller ones. A 10 mg gummy might fade in a few hours, while a 50 mg can last much longer and may cause stronger side effects.
Tolerance changes how long you feel the effects. Regular use builds tolerance, so you may need more to feel the same duration. To get longer effects without increasing your dose, try spacing out doses or taking a tolerance break.
Start low and go slow. Keep track of your dose, timing, and how long effects last to find a safe routine.
Food Intake and Hydration
Taking delta 8 gummies with a fatty meal increases absorption and can make effects last longer. A light snack or an empty stomach may speed up the onset but shorten the duration.
Staying hydrated can help reduce side effects like dry mouth or lightheadedness, but it doesn’t change how much delta 8 you absorb. Alcohol and other substances can interact with delta 8, so avoid mixing until you know how your body responds.
For reliable timing, take gummies with the same meal and water each time. Staff at local shops can help you choose products and dosing to match your needs.
How Long Do Delta 8 Gummies Stay In Your System?
Delta-8 can stay in your system and show up on drug tests for days to weeks, depending on your dose, frequency, and body chemistry. Detection windows vary for urine, blood, saliva, and hair tests.
Detectability Windows for Delta-8
Urine tests are the most common. A single low dose may be detectable for 3–7 days. Regular or heavy use can show up for 2–4 weeks or longer. Blood tests detect delta-8 for a shorter time, usually 1–2 days after a single dose. Chronic use may extend this to several days.
Saliva tests rarely target delta-8 specifically but can detect recent use within 24–72 hours. Hair tests may show use for months, up to 90 days, but are less common for routine screening.
Factors Affecting Elimination
Larger doses stay in your system longer, increasing THC metabolite levels and detection time. Frequent use allows delta-8 to build up in fat tissue, slowing elimination and lengthening detection windows.
Your body fat, age, metabolism, hydration, and liver health all affect how quickly you clear cannabinoids.
Exercise and diet can change metabolism, but won’t guarantee a negative test. Product quality and accurate labeling help you know your dose and purity. Always start with a low dose and follow age guidelines.
Differences from Other THC Edibles
Delta-8 is chemically similar to delta-9 THC, so many drug tests cannot distinguish between them. Tests usually look for THC metabolites, not the specific type.
Delta-9 gummies often have similar detection windows. Some delta-9 products contain higher THC doses, which can make detection last longer than low-dose delta-8.
Full-spectrum hemp edibles may contain multiple cannabinoids that affect metabolism and test results. Always check third-party lab reports (COAs) for potency and THC content before use.
Shelf Life and Expiration of Delta 8 Gummies
Delta 8 gummies lose potency and quality over time. Storing them properly helps preserve flavor, texture, and effects.
How to Tell If Your Gummies Have Expired
Check the pack date or “best by” date on the label first. Use the lot number to check the COA or ask staff if needed.
Look for these signs:
- Smell change: A sour or off odor means breakdown or contamination.
- Texture shift: Hard, dry, or melted clumps signal lost quality.
- Color change: Darkening or uneven spots may mean oxidation or mold.
- Weaker effects: If the Delta 8 feels much weaker than before, the potency dropped.
If you see mold, a strong chemical smell, or wet spots, throw the gummies away. Do not eat expired Delta 8 gummies if you’re unsure about safety. Keep records of purchase dates to track when potency may fall.
Optimal Storage Practices
Store gummies in a cool, dark, dry place away from light and heat. Heat melts gummies and speeds up cannabinoid breakdown.
Follow these tips:
- Use original packaging with a tight seal or transfer to an airtight container.
- Keep at stable temps: 50–70°F is ideal. Avoid hot cars and sunny windows.
- Limit humidity: Add a desiccant packet if the container allows one.
- Avoid the fridge for long-term storage unless recommended; condensation can form when you open cold containers.
Label the container with purchase and opened dates. If you buy lab-tested Delta 8 gummies, follow storage directions on the COA or label to preserve potency and safety.
What Are Delta 8 Gummies?
Delta 8 gummies are chewable edibles containing delta-8-tetrahydrocannabinol (delta-8 THC). Each piece gives you a measured dose, making dosing simpler than with flower or tinctures.
They come in different flavors, shapes, and strengths. Many people use them to relax, sleep, or reduce mild stress. Always check lab results and start with a low dose.
How They Differ from Other THC Edibles
Delta-8 THC is a cannabinoid similar to delta-9 THC but usually produces milder effects. Many users report less anxiety and clearer thinking compared to typical delta-9 edibles.
Delta-8 can be hemp-derived and federally compliant if it meets legal requirements. State laws vary, so check local rules before buying. For dosing, start with a low amount, wait at least two hours, and avoid mixing with alcohol or other drugs.
Common Ingredients and Formulation
Most delta 8 gummies use hemp-derived delta-8 THC isolate or broad-spectrum distillate. Typical ingredients include sugar, pectin or gelatin, fruit juice concentrates, natural flavors, and food coloring.
Look for a Certificate of Analysis (COA) showing potency and absence of contaminants like solvents, pesticides, and heavy metals.
Some formulas add CBD, terpenes, or melatonin for specific effects. Trusted shops list exact milligrams per gummy and batch COAs. Ask for lab results and dosing advice during in-store or online purchases if you have questions.
